Choosing multi-functional furniture for student housing is an excellent strategy to maximize space and functionality. Here's what you need to know to make informed decisions:

Understanding Space Limitations

Before you start shopping, grab a tape measure and note down the dimensions of your room. Understanding your space is crucial for selecting pieces that fit perfectly without making the room feel cramped.

Opt for Convertible Pieces

One of the best ways to maximize space is by choosing furniture that can serve multiple purposes. Think about a sofa bed that acts as a couch during the day and a bed at night. Similarly, a lift-top coffee table can function as a coffee table, a desk, and even provide extra storage space.

Prioritize Storage

Storage solutions are a lifesaver in small spaces. Look for beds with built-in drawers, ottomans with hidden compartments, and bookshelves with cubbies. These options not only keep your space organized but also reduce clutter, making your room feel more spacious.

Durability and Quality Matter

Furniture in student housing has to withstand a lot of wear and tear. It’s wise to invest in pieces made from solid wood or metal, which are generally more durable than those made from particle board. This ensures your furniture can handle the daily rigors of student life.

Easy Maintenance

Students are busy, so choosing furniture that is easy to clean is a must. Leather or faux leather seating can be wiped down quickly, and darker fabrics are better at hiding stains. This saves time and keeps your space looking fresh.

Aesthetics Count

The appearance of your furniture can significantly impact your mood and productivity. Choose colors and styles that you find inviting and motivating. Creating a positive and aesthetically pleasing environment can make a huge difference in your daily life.

Mobility and Flexibility

Lightweight furniture or pieces with wheels can be incredibly beneficial in a student housing setting. This allows you to easily reconfigure your space for different activities, whether it’s studying, entertaining friends, or just relaxing.

Eco-Friendly Choices

Think about the environmental impact of your furniture. Opt for pieces made from sustainable materials or those certified by environmental standards. Not only is this better for the planet, but it can also contribute to a healthier living environment.

Check Reviews and Warranties

Before making any purchases, read reviews to see how the furniture has performed for other users. Also, check if the items come with warranties for added peace of mind.
